discuz第二次开发是什么
时间 : 2023-11-09 08:39: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
Discuz是一个开源的社区论坛软件,第二次开发是对Discuz论坛进行二次开发、定制化改造或功能扩展的过程。第二次开发的目的是根据用户需求,对Discuz进行个性化定制,以满足不同网站的特殊需求。
在第二次开发中,可以对Discuz的功能进行扩展、改进或修改。以下是一些可能的第二次开发任务:
1. 主题定制:根据网站的风格和需求,进行主题定制,包括论坛样式、色彩、背景等,以使其符合网站的整体风格。
2. 功能扩展:对Discuz进行功能扩展,可以根据网站的需求,添加一些定制的功能模块,如签到系统、积分系统、活动管理等。
3. 第三方插件集成:根据网站需求,将适用的第三方插件集成到Discuz中,如支付接口、社交媒体登录、邮件推送等。
4. 用户权限管理:根据网站需求,对用户权限进行定制,例如增加新的用户组、设置特定用户组的权限、用户注册审核等。
5. 数据库优化:对Discuz的数据库进行分析和优化,以提高Discuz论坛的性能和稳定性。
6. 安全性加强:增加安全性措施,如加密用户密码、防止恶意攻击、防止垃圾信息等。
7. 移动端适配:将Discuz论坛适配至移动端,以提供更好的移动用户体验。
第二次开发可以根据具体需求进行定制,使得Discuz论坛能够更好地满足网站的需求和目标,提升用户体验和网站的整体价值。
其他答案
Discuz是一款基于PHP语言开发的开源论坛程序,它具有良好的可定制性和扩展性,因此被广泛应用于各类论坛和社区网站。而Discuz的第二次开发则是在Discuz基础上进行二次开发,以满足特定需求或定制功能。
Discuz的第二次开发可以分为前端开发和后端开发两部分。前端开发主要涉及对Discuz模板进行修改和优化,以满足网站的设计需求和用户体验,包括界面风格、布局调整、添加新的页面等。后端开发主要涉及对Discuz的核心功能进行扩展和定制,以满足网站的特殊功能需求,包括用户权限管理、数据统计分析、社区功能扩展等。
通过Discuz的第二次开发,可以实现以下功能和特性:
1. 用户认证和权限管理:根据网站的需求,可以实现自定义的用户认证方式和权限管理机制,例如通过第三方登录、手机验证码登录等。
2. 自定义用户界面和交互:通过对Discuz模板进行修改,可以实现网站的独特界面风格和用户交互体验,提升用户满意度。
3. 社交功能扩展:通过添加新的功能模块,如微博、群组、私信等,可以打造更丰富的社交平台。
4. 数据统计和分析:根据网站的需求,可以进行数据统计和分析,例如用户活跃度统计、热门主题分析等。
5. 第三方集成和插件开发:通过与其他系统或服务的集成,可以实现更多的功能扩展,例如与支付系统的集成、推送服务的集成等。
尽管Discuz已经具备许多功能和特性,但是由于每个网站的需求不同,因此进行第二次开发是为了更好地满足特定需求。通过合理的、高质量的第二次开发,可以让Discuz成为一个功能强大、定制性高的论坛和社区平台。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章